MAT.APP.(F.C.) 148/2019 & CM No.24053/2019 (for stay) 2.
The appellant is aggrieved by the order dated 06.05.2019 passed by the Family Court (South), Saket Courts, New Delhi, whereunder an application moved by the respondent/husband under Section 12 of the Guardian and Wards Act, 1890 for seeking interim custody and visitation rights of the minor son of the parties, aged 2 years, has been allowed to the limited extent that the respondent/husband has been granted visitation rights in respect of the child on every 4th Saturday of the month only for half an hour.

3.
After addressing arguments for some time, Mr.Batra, learned Senior counsel appearing for the appellant states, on instructions that presently the appellant does not wish to press this appeal. Instead, she reserves her right to approach the Family Court in the event the child is uncomfortable and resists meeting his father even for 30 minutes on a monthly basis in terms of the impugned order.
4.
Leave, as prayed for, is granted.
The appeal is dismissed as not pressed along with CM No.24053/2019.
